Azerbaijan expects concrete steps from European countries in regulating Internet-media: head of presidential administration department

04 June 2009 [09:55] - TODAY.AZ
Azerbaijan expects concrete steps from the European countries in regulating Internet-media, Head of the Public-Political Department of the Presidential Administration Ali Hasanov said at the conference on "Regulating Internet-media in Azerbaijan", organized by the Council of Europe (CE) and the Azerbaijan National Television and Radio Council.
"Azerbaijan will also take relevant measures, when the European countries take concrete steps in this field. The information society plays a serious role in country's foreign and interior policy," Hasanov said.

"Several years ago, we wanted to establish the relevant body to supervise over the Internet in Azerbaijan," the head of the department said. "But at that time, we underwent criticism and established only the National Television and Radio Council. Internet-media can entail the whole society. It is enough to remember the reports in the Armenian electronic media which could make Turkey and Azerbaijan enemies," Hasanov said.
